The (Japanese: {{hover|かいりゅう|Kairyū}} ''Sea Dragon'') is a [[class]] and subspecies of [[dragon]] that has never made an official appearance in the {{FES}}. While data for the Sea Dragon class is present in {{FE3}}, it is never used, and the Sea Dragon is not present in any form in any other installment. Many of its map animations are still in the game, though only one frame of its idle animation remains. Its moving map sprite resembles a sea serpent in appearance, while its battle sprite is the same as a [[Fire Dragon]]. It can move freely in seas, similarly to [[Pirate]]s.

As it is a dragon class, it may have been intended to be usable as a [[manakete]] transformation; however, no transformation [[Stone (weapon)|stone]] that would allow for such a transformation survives in the game's code, though a leftover name string in the game's debug menu, the (Japanese: {{hover|かいりゅうせき|Kairyū seki}} ''Sea Dragonstone''),<ref>{{Cite web| quote= Evidently, this slot was once intended for a matching dragonstone for the unused ocean dragon class. It was eventually replaced with the Part 2 variant of Aum. | url= https://tcrf.net/Fire_Emblem:_Monshou_no_Nazo/Debug_Menu | title= Fire Emblem: Monshou no Nazo/Debug Menu | site= tcrf.net }}</ref> suggests there was one in development at some point. No [[Breath (weapon)|breath]] weapon, existing or otherwise, is known to be associated with the class. However, it can use any breath that is cheated into its inventory.

While not coded into the game, a sea dragon boss, known as Neptune (Japanese: {{hover|ネプチューン|Nepuchūn}} ''Neptune''), was planned to be featured in {{FE1}}. It was supposed to attack with tornadoes rather than breath, and its attack animation was intended to have it conjure a spell with its hands.<ref>[http://serenesforest.net/2016/01/07/making-of-shadow-dragon-nes/ Making of ''Shadow Dragon'' (NES) - Serenes Forest]</ref> Interestingly, the Sea Dragon's remaining map sprite data also seems to depict it attacking with tornadoes while moving its hands.
